PCC Programs and Committees

There are many exciting events that occur throughout the year which help to supplement your children's education. If it were not for your generous time and donations we would not be able to pay for and supplement these programs.

The PCC through our fundraising efforts are able to cover the costs of Field Trips, Enrichment programs, Educational programs, Student/Teacher Supplies, Donations/Community Service programs, Teacher Appreciation and 8th Grade Programs.

RALLY FOR REMINGTON

Direct Donation Program to help supplement field trips for all grades, student activities and all events at Remington. We really want to make a BIG push with direct donation by promoting and also adding a PayPal facility for online payments. This program gives us the biggest return as we receive 100% of all donations rather than a percentage as in other fundraising events. This will be promoted via flyers in the folders sent home at the start of the school year, email and PCC Facebook page.

STUDENT ACTIVITIES

This committee will organize activities for students, i.e., movie nights, trivia night, etc.. Our principals are very excited about this committee and promise to attend these events. Flyers will need to be designed. Volunteers are needed to help with concession sales and the door.

REMAPALOOZA

This committee will coordinate and organize Remapalooza. This is the PCC’s largest fundraisers and one of the most popular events of the school year. There are inflatables, a silent auction, raffle, dunk tank., music. An outline and information from the previous year will be provided. Many Co-Chairs and volunteers are needed to help with the fundraiser. High School students can volunteer to earn service hours the day of the event.

READING PROGRAM

This committee will work with designated staff to collect lists of the students who completed the summer reading challenge. A gift will be purchased by the PCC and delivered to the students during homeroom who have met the requirement. The students names will also be included in an article and sent to the local paper.

YEARBOOK

This committee will work with a teacher who is organizing the yearbook throughout the year to photograph, gather pictures and deliver them to school so that the yearbook can be designed and put together.

COMMUNITY EVENTS

Committee will reach out to charitable organizations to partner with Remington to have a clothing drive, electronics drive, book drive. Obtain information from the organization's, forward to PCC President and will be presented to the Principal for approval and a date will be chosen. Once the date(s) have been established, flyers will need to be made so it can be sent out to parents and home. PCC will work to advertise to the community.

HOSPITALITY

Bakers are needed! We are looking for some generous people who love to bake (or buy) to help us out during our bake sales for conferences, teacher luncheons, and Remapalooza. A Sign-Up-Genius form will be created so you can bake as much or as little a you want.

8th GRADE CELEBRATION

  • FIELD DAY: This committee of 7th & 8th grade parents will meet to plan an all day field day that takes place at King Street Park. Vendors, volunteers, food donations will need to be organized. An outline from the previous year will be provided.

  • SOCIAL: This committee of 7th & 8th grade parents will meet to plan a dance for the 8th grade students. A theme will need to be decided, volunteers, donations will also need to be organized and the cafeteria decorated. One of the most anticipated events for the 8th graders to celebrate their 3 years at Remington!

  • BREAKFAST: A committee of 7th & 8th grade parents will organize a breakfast for the 8th graders on the last day of school. This is a special morning of awards and student recognition.
